Embassy of Sri Lanka in Amman organizes Sri Lanka tourism promotional event

The Embassy of Sri Lanka in Jordan organized a tourism promotional event with the aim to promote Sri Lanka as one of the top tourist destinations for Jordanian travellers, while portraying the country’s vibrant culture. Held at the Corp Hotel in Amman recently , the event saw the participation of tour operators, airline representatives, media personnel, popular bloggers/YouTubers, and other stakeholders.

Renewal of the Bilateral Currency swap Agreement signed between the Central Bank of Sri Lanka and the People’s Bank of china

 

The Central Bank of Sri Lanka and the People’s Bank of China, in December 2024, successfully renewed the Bilateral Currency Swap Agreement signed in 2021, for a period of another three (03) years, under the terms and conditions stipulated in the original agreement. The CNY 10 billion (approximately USD 1.4 billion) currency swap facility reflects the financial cooperation between China and Sri Lanka.
